  • Oaks Book Offering & Sales Discounts!

    Oaks are a keystone species supporting more wildlife that any other tree species in our region. To promote these ecological foundations, we're lending out copies of "The Nature of Oaks" by Doug Tallamy AND offering 33% off Oaks in the Spring Tree & Shrub Sale!

  • Ann Arbor STEAM Native Pollinator Garden Post-install

    Ann Arbor STEAM Northside leveraged the School and Community Habitat Grant to develop an incredible project at their school. Utilizing class participation, they applied for and installed a native pollinator garden on school grounds. They were engaged with real problems like erosion, enhanced plant diversity, and put on a showcase of the diverse native plants found in Southeast Michigan.

  • EMU Children's Institute's Rain Play Garden Post-install

    The EMU Children’s Institute successfully utilized the SCHG to create an interactive Rain Play Garden. Supported by partner Feral Flora, the project mobilized over 40 community volunteers and students to dig and install "mini-raingardens" directly into the nature playground. This hands-on initiative exists as an educational space that inspires environmental curiosity while improving the resilience of the school's landscape.
